Subject: DR drill — Matchwell pause spikes

During Thursday's disaster-recovery drill, the Pairline matching service showed GC pauses up to 900ms under replayed load, delaying failover validation. I've annotated the heap dumps in the review branch for your inspection. To restore the standby coordinator during the drill, enter the passphrase exactly as shown below.

recovery phrase for bawep-kawef: oliath-casdor

Before cutting a release, the snapshot suite must pass against the golden image store, not local fixtures; local-only passes have previously masked font-rendering drift. If snapshots diverge en masse, check whether the render container was rebuilt with a new base image, and pin it back before re-baselining. The CI job reads the golden-store endpoint from the release env file, which you own as release manager. That file must also contain the golden-store access secret, added on the line below.

secret setting of hawep-yahig: LEDGER_TOKEN29=41b5d6315371c92885eaeb077fb63

14:22 — Offline sync regression confirmed (Terrapath field-survey app)

At 14:22 the on-call engineer reproduced the data-loss path: surveys saved while offline were marked synced once connectivity returned, even when the upload was rejected. The queue flush skipped the server acknowledgement check introduced in the previous sprint. Release manager note: the fix must ship before the coastal survey season. The offending build is identified by the token recorded below.

session token of kawif-fawig = htk31_f3f599be2b1a34affb1efa8d0feccf8

// So, the Quillbase planner started picking nested-loop joins on
// tables over 2M rows after we tweaked the cost model. This
// constant restores the old row-estimate floor until we figure
// out why the stats sampler undercounts. Worth five minutes at
// the sync. The regression first appeared in the build noted
// just below.

build token for kagaf-hahof: htk14_9d3d4d26d7d8de